What is a Yorkie Poo?
The Yorkie Poo is a designer type resulting from crossing a [Yorkshire Terrier Welpe Kaufen](http://175.178.150.62:3002/yorkshire-terrier-baby8214) Terrier (Yorkie) and a Poodle (normally a Toy or Miniature Poodle). This hybrid is celebrated not only for its aesthetic appeal however also for its friendly behavior and adaptability to numerous living scenarios.

While Yorkie Poos normally enjoy health, they can acquire certain conditions from their parent breeds. Here are some typical health issues to look for:
ConditionDescriptionPatellar LuxationA common concern in small types where the kneecap dislocates.Hip DysplasiaA genetic condition impacting the hip joint.AllergiesSome Yorkie Poos might establish skin allergies.Oral ProblemsSmall breeds are susceptible to oral concerns.
Routine veterinary check-ups are important to monitor and keep the health of your Yorkie Poo.

How long do Yorkie Poos live?
Yorkie Poos usually have a life expectancy of 12-15 years, presuming they are well looked after.
2. Are Yorkie Poos hypoallergenic?
While no canine is totally hypoallergenic, Yorkie Poos tend to produce less dander, making them a better alternative for [Yorki online shop](https://code.smartscf.cn/yorkies-online-shop3682) allergy victims.
3. Do Yorkie Poos shed?
Yorkie Poos have hair rather of fur, which suggests they shed very little. Routine grooming helps further handle any loose hair.
